Overview""The Golden Health Library, Volume Two"" serves as a comprehensive guide to medical knowledge and personal wellness from the early twentieth century. Compiled by Lane, this volume represents a significant historical snapshot of the health and hygiene standards of the late 1920s, offering readers a window into the evolution of medical advice and home-care practices. The work covers a broad spectrum of topics essential to the maintenance of health, providing practical instructions and insights intended for the layperson of the era. As part of a larger encyclopedic effort to democratize medical information, this volume emphasizes the importance of prevention, cleanliness, and the understanding of common ailments. It bridges the gap between professional medical expertise and domestic application, making it an invaluable resource for those interested in the history of medicine, the development of public health initiatives, and the social history of the interwar period. Readers will find a wealth of information regarding physical well-being, reflecting the scientific understanding and cultural attitudes toward health that helped shape the modern approach to personal care. ""The Golden Health Library, Volume Two"" remains a fascinating artifact for researchers and history enthusiasts alike, documenting the transition into modern health awareness and the persistent human quest for longevity and vitality.
